    PSx CD-Gen creates currupt images use CDGENPS2 v3.0 instead, then patch with PATCH-IT to add the license data and then BootEdit v2.0 to add the tmd graphic.
    Make sure no errors are in the image after patching by scanning it with CDMage.
    Patching alone with BootEdit has in the past currupted images for me as it doesn't already have the license data added so it places it in the wrong area that's why you need to patch with PATCH-IT first so it's got the data their already to overwrite.

    2. Software and hardware needed
    As for the hardware chip is required to change a Playstation and a PC
    necessarily the last generation (of course it is always the rule that the speed
    in the conversion is directly proportional to the computational capacity of your PC).
    Make sure your hard drive has as much free space as possible considering that
    For example, a 10-minute AVI, 320x240, 25 fps, DivX ;-) compressed (but with no sound
    compressed) occupies, roughly, 150Mb and that, once converted. STR, the size will be
    increased by almost 1 / 3 (example: 150Mb + (1 / 3) * 150Mb = 200Mb).
    The necessary software is, however, the following:
    Movie Converter - software for converting AVI! STR
    STRPlay (or similar) - Software for viewing movies on a PC STR
    And 'advisable, before making a copy on CD-R, burn a CD-RW and a
    Then check the correct operation through a PSX emulator (I use the Bleem! but
    PSEmu2000 also goes' well if we have available at least 128Mb of RAM).
    Please note that When viewing a VideoCD using an emulator does not always sound
    is performed successfully even, at times, is totally ignored. If this
    happens you can still rest easy because, once copied everything
    CD-R and inserted into the psx, VideoCD work properly, including audio!
    As for burning the CD you need a program capable of reading
    files. CUE or. ISO, with respect to. CDRWin CUE can be used or, for those who suffer
    with this software (such as my Yamaha), you can use the suite Blind
    Read & Write (able to read. CUE). For those who do not "love" burning software
    listed above can easily use any software capable of burning
    . ISO (as, for example, Easy CD Creator).

    4. How to convert .avi / .STR
    Our aim will be to get a file. STR from a movie. AVI, having the
    same contribution Audio / Video. It 'easy to understand how the two files will not
    "Exactly" the same content but it will differ in some parameters such as quality
    Audio (STR's do not support a higher audio with 37.8 kHz), the FPS (but they do not
    always differ from the original) and, of course, the compression (quality of STR
    less compared to AVI).
    It is considered that the user has already, ready to be converted, its AVI files (no more than
    four) with a resolution of 320x240 and a maximum of 7.20 minutes (for each
    movie).
    Please note that Before proceeding with the conversion is necessary to explain that the AVI
    departure should not have any audio compression! Are only permitted
    video compression.
    The steps are as follows:
    1) Open the Video Converter program, and clicking on the box 1, select the file. Avi from
    convert (in the box below it is required that the avi is "uncompressed",
    I personally have done tests with compressed avi DivX ;-) and I have not had any
    problem). Automatically, in box 2 will show the name of the file after purchase
    conversion, using the box at the bottom of the extension will select str (MDEC)
    (Example: box1 "prova.avi" - box2 "prova.str")
    6
    2) Clicking on the Attributes you can set the (few) parameters in our
    available. From the testing I can advise you to leave everything unchanged except
    options "Leap sector" and "Sound" to be both turned on. However
    Frame rate is about the value of ... well, of course you should set it according to what
    related to the movie you want to convert avi (for example: the movie in the Win95 CD
    has 15 fps, a value definitely different from that of an ordinary movie PAL or NTSC).
    3) Once the setting panel on the attributes of the file. Str will
    Just click on the button "Go" to start conversion.
    Please note that After the conversion, if you want to create VideoCD, you will need to copy
    . STR in the \ VIDEO VideoCD.ZIP created by unzipping the file. Just copied the
    you have to rename files in 1.STR, 2.STR and so on up to a total of four files (if
    movies are fewer than four will need to modify the file VideoCD.CTI
    using the information in section 5.2 of this guide). Run the file
    ESEGUIMI.BAT and expect that the operations are finished, open your
    and poured burning software on a CD using the image CD.CUE
    or CD.iso. When done, insert the CD in the Playstation and enjoy movies
    obtained.

    Reader 6.1. Playstation STR
    For movies made on our PC are correctly decoded by our Psx is
    need software (from now on referred to as "reader-psx") able to read
    these files. It 'obvious that this software can "run" only if run from a psx, is therefore
    useless to try to run that program on a PC. This imaginary reader-psx
    is simply an executable that deals with both of the movies on the CD to start a
    simple interface, complete with graphics for video management.
    I reported in the figure below captures the screen of the reader-psx (Keep
    to specify that the background image is that the buttons on the left have been realized by
    signed with Lightwave and Photoshop) running the CD over the Bleem!
    9
    After a sufficient number of tests, this guide covers the reader, you can
    draw the following considerations:
    • the maximum resolution allowed is 320x240, this implies a quality of movies
    totally objectionable
    • The color depth is managed by the PSX (only) 16 bit and this translates into a
    unsatisfactory display in the scenes where you have shades and gradients
    particularly complex
    • The player can recognize a maximum of four movies and each movie is not
    must be more than 7 minutes and 25 seconds, which means a total of 29 minutes
    and 40 seconds of viewing. Even here you can guess how it all is very limiting if
    you think that in a CD, you could bring up to ~ 40 minutes of contribution
    Audio / Video!
    • movies viewed on Psx not appear to be perfectly centered with the TV but some
    cm (4-5) "up", producing a black stripe at the bottom of the screen.
    To overcome this problem should be needed a TV that supports the standard
    NTSC, you can also use one of those utilities can be easily found on the Internet,
    dealing with changing the boot of PSX PAL to NTSC (I solved the problem
    using this method) or (probably) the cable NTSC / PAL for sale in all
    stores carrying material for the PSX
    • making a movie at 25 fps and displaying it on the PSX is known, after a few minutes,
    a lag that sees the audio ahead of video
    From the above we can easily deduce that, while able to visualize their
    Psx movies can be interesting and pleasant, the other must be emphasized as the
    quality is a factor to be discussed throughout. If anyone was hoping to make copies of
    your DVD or SVCD for viewing on your PSX, ... well, he understands that the finished product
    will never be equal, the movies do not exceed the final (and perhaps even reach) the quality
    VHS. It 'may still exist around the network of readers with more specific
    "Wow".

    6.2 The file. CTI, and BuildCD StripISO
    The. CTI is nothing but the table of contents of a CD, it is in fact
    describes the structure, the directories and files to be included on the media (the CD). A. CTI go
    then associated with the use of BuildCD that, by setting the appropriate parameters, is used to
    the creation of the file. IMG, that is the image of the CD "virtual". To clarify the discussion
    Consider, as an example, the file in the archive VideoCD.CTI VideoCD.ZIP attached
    this guide. To view the content of the file VideoCD.CTI simply use a
    any text editor (notepad, wordpad, etc.). Now we will analyze, with large heads, the code
    of that file:
    the first dealing with strings identifying the name of the disk (XA_PSX), the lead in and
    track format (XA, the format for the PSX), and also connecting to the file 2352.DAT,
    initialization of the system areas
    Disc XA_PSX
    LeadIn XA
    Empty 1000
    Postgap 150
    EndTrack
    Track XA
    Pause 150
    Volume ISO9660
    SystemArea 2352.DAT
    11
    Then we initialize the identifiers of the CD and that is: the system identifier, the
    type of CD (as a demo or GAME), the type of application and anything useful for
    identification:
    PrimaryVolume
    SystemIdentifier "PLAYSTATION"
    VolumeIdentifier "DEMO"
    VolumeSetIdentifier "DEMO"
    PublisherIdentifier "PSX"
    DataPreparerIdentifier "DEMO"
    ApplicationIdentifier "DEMO"
    Lpath
    OptionalLpath
    Mpath
    OptionalMpath
    The subsequent deal with strings instead of drawing the shaft of the CD: folders under
    folders and files. Then analyze the code carefully, reminding us that all the folders and
    files that are "created" are actually to be considered as "created in the image of the IMG
    CD Burn ":
    Hierarchy
    File PSX.EXE;
    XAFileAttributes on Form1
    Source psx.exe
    EndFile
    File SYSTEM.CNF
    XAFileAttributes Form1 Date
    Source SYSTEM.CNF
    EndFile
    File CONFIG.DAT
    XAFileAttributes Form1 Date
    Source CONFIG.DAT
    EndFile
    12
    The three files PSX.EXE, SYSTEM.CNF CONFIG.DAT and will then be copied to the root of the CD, the
    PSX.EXE files that will appear on the CD has as its source (SOURCE) This file PSX.EXE
    VideoCD.ZIP in the archive. The same can be reported for the two files
    SYSTEM.CNF and CONFIG.DAT
    The procedure stated above also applies to the creation of subfolders and files to copy
    inside:
    ICONS directory / * CREATE DIRECTORY ICONS
    File 1.TIM / * CREATE THE FILES INSIDE 1.TIM
    Date XAFileAttributes Form1 / * FILE IDENTIFIER OF WAY (XA)
    Source icons \ 1.TIM / * CREATE THE FILE STARTING FROM 1.TIM
    EndFile / * END
    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...
    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..
    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..
    EndDirectory / * CLOSE THE DIRECTORY ICONS
    The same procedure must be 'then repeated for all other directories to create.
    With regard to the VIDEO folder is important to make a small observation: by default
    our file. CTI creates four files (1.STR, 2.STR, and 3.STR 4.STR) inside the folder
    Video image by copying them from their four files that are in the VIDEO folder
    present on your hard drive (found VideoCD.ZIP unzipping). You will definitely
    understood that the four files in question are none other than our movies that previously,
    we just copied into the VIDEO! It follows that, if we wanted to
    insert the CD only a movie (and not four, as is the default) should eliminate
    strings on the file creation 2.3 and 4!
    13
    Suppose you want to create a CD with just one movie, if not eliminate the strings on
    the other three movies, the BuildCD will fail with an error that no physical
    of the three movies! However, if you delete these strings must realize that the BuildCD
    create a CD containing a single movie and will not give any errors!
    Video Directory
    File 1.STR
    Video XASource \ 1.STR
    EndFile
    File 2.STR
    Video XASource \ 2.STR
    EndFile
    File 3.STR
    Video XASource \ 3.STR
    EndFile
    File 3.STR
    Video XASource \ 3.STR
    EndFile
    EndDirectory
    EndHierarchy
    The last lines of code instead of the deal closing (lead-out) of the CD.
    EndPrimaryVolume
    EndVolume
    Postgap 150
    EndTrack
    Leadout XA
    Empty 150
    EndTrack
    EndDisc
    14
    Once analyzed the functioning of the file. CTI, and modifying it according to our
    needs, you should use in sequence and BuildCD StripISO.
    BuildCD (as mentioned above) takes care of creating an image file. IMG
    representing the contents of the entire CD; StripISO handles instead of producing, starting
    BuildCD image created from a file. ISO to use with common software
    burning. Both programs "run" under DOS so you have to run from
    Prompt, to create a file with BuildCD must use the-i [filename.img] followed
    the file name. CTI wrote earlier (in our case: VideoCD.CTI).
    The correct command line is:
    buildcd-ivideo.img VideoCD.cti
    BuildCD start the process the. VIDEO.IMG CTI will create the file with the specific
    required. At the end of the transaction (which may take several minutes), simply press the
    'Esc' key on your keyboard to exit the program.
    To convert the file from. IMG. StripISO.EXE ISO just run the file with the following
    options
    stripiso 2352 video.img video.iso
    the value 2352 corresponds to the way of writing that, in our case, is the RAW.
    VIDEO.ISO the file you just created you need to add the file 2352.DAT (which deals with the
    write mode) using the COPY command with option B (binary data) enabled:
    copy / B + 2352.dat video.iso CD.iso
    When finished we will have, at last, our CD.iso files ready to burn!
